Plugin Alliance $20 Voucher, No Minimum Spend!
chris.r replied to Patrick Wichrowski's topic in Deals
Eryk, but that could potentially lead to some trouble in future. Say I will re-install or migrate Windows in a few years and forget about all this, I'll end up with no vst3 presets wondering what I did couple years ago to make them work. Wish there would be a simpler solution like pointing to the correct path on disk, but don't know how. For now I see at least 3 different locations. For example Opticon XLA-3 presets are in 'Documents\VST3 Presets\Plugin Alliance' and they don't show up as most if not all from this path, and there are most of them (50). Lindell PEX-500 presets are in both 'AppData\Roaming\VST3 Presets\Plugin Alliance' and 'C:\VST3 Presets\Plugin Alliance' and they do show up in Cakewalk so they are read from one of these places I guess. But... in 'AppData\Roaming\VST3 Presets\Plugin Alliance' there are also presets for Lindell TE-100 and NEOLD BIG AL, Lindell presets do show up in Cakewalk but BIG AL are not... what gives?? I would prefer to read the original preset files from a correct path on disk as that's the manufacturer's 'proprietary' preset system, if I update a plugin and it's presets will get updated too, I want Cakewalk to read the updated presets from their original location. Doubt the '.SPP' way would do it. -
